uncouth
uncouth/ʌnˈku:θ; ʌn`kuθ/ adj(of people, their appearance, behaviour, etc) rough, awkward or ill-mannered; not refined (指人、 人的外表、 行为等)粗野的, 笨拙的, 无礼貌的, 无教养的. 牛津英汉双解词典
